Coat Color And Grooming Needs Of Scottish Terriers
At first sight, you may think a Scottish Terrier only comes in a black coat. But he doesnāt. This dog can also be in brindle, wheaten, steel, or gray. A Scottie (shortened label for the breed) with a wheaten coat resembles the White Terriers of the West Highlands. This case isnāt surprising since the two breeds have an intertwined origin.
A Scottie has a dual-layered coat. His over or topcoat is wiry and hard, whereas his under or bottom coat is dense and soft. He only sheds minimally as his hair continuously grows. His skin is always dry, so heās not recommended to bathe very often ā only when necessary.
Many assume that a Scottie is low-maintenance in terms of grooming. But he isnāt since he requires regular grooming. For one, his coat needs daily grooming if heās being shown and weekly if heās kept as a pet.Ā Ā

obvs the norwich/norfolk and smooth/wire fox terriers are clear examples, but broader also: the road isn't all that long from a lakeland to a welsh terrier, and they are both fox terriers in form and function. if we take a step to the left, irish terriers are taller and lighter in build, but overall similar. staying there, kerry blue largely came out of wheaten terriers. sealyhams are said to have influence from fox terriers and westies, but despite some details (ears and the longer body) are built on a frame very similar to scotties. scotties came from the same stock as cairns and westies. dandie dinmonts are just as bizarre as they've always been, so i'm not sure you could change it if you tried. and no one seems to agree on what exactly a jack russell terrier is anyway.
Today's tepid take is that there is absolutely no - none, zero - good reason for any of the british terrier breeds to not outcross to each other

Scottish Terrier: The "Scottie"
The Scottish Terrier, also known as the "Scottie," is a small but mighty dog breed that originated in Scotland. These dogs were originally bred to hunt rodents, and they have a strong prey drive that makes them excellent hunters. Scotties have a distinctive appearance with their long, shaggy hair and short legs.
Breed Overview: - HEIGHT:Ā 10 inches - WEIGHT:Ā 18 to 22 pounds - PHYSICAL CHARACTERISTICS:Ā Short and stout; double coat; longer fur on the face, legs, and lower body Appearance and Characteristics Scotties are small dogs that typically weigh between 19 and 23 pounds. They have a thick, wiry coat that comes in a range of colors, including black, wheaten, and brindle. Their ears are pointed and stand erect, and their tails are short and carried straight up. The Scottie's face is characterized by its long, bushy beard and eyebrows. Personality Traits Scotties are known for their strong-willed, independent personalities. They are loyal and protective of their owners, but they can also be stubborn and aloof. These dogs require a lot of socialization and training from a young age to prevent them from becoming overly aggressive. Health Issues Scotties are prone to several health issues, including bladder cancer, skin cancer, and a neurological disorder called Scottie cramp. They can also develop allergies and joint problems. Regular veterinary check-ups and a healthy diet are essential for keeping your Scottie healthy.
Cairn Terrier: The "Toto" Dog
The Cairn Terrier, also known as the "Toto" dog from the Wizard of Oz, is another small Scottish dog breed that was originally bred for hunting. These dogs are known for their lively personalities and charming looks. Cairns are very loyal to their families and make great pets for families with children.
Breed Overview: - HEIGHT:Ā 9 to 10 inches - WEIGHT:Ā 12 to 15 pounds - PHYSICAL CHARACTERISTICS:Ā Double coat with a wiry outer coat; comes in a wide range of colors Appearance and Characteristics Cairns are small dogs that typically weigh between 13 and 18 pounds. They have a shaggy coat that comes in a range of colors, including cream, wheaten, red, and gray. Cairns have short legs, pointed ears that stand erect, and a bushy tail. Personality Traits Cairns are outgoing, friendly dogs that love to play and explore. They are intelligent and have a strong instinct to hunt, so they require plenty of exercise and mental stimulation. Cairns are also known for their loyalty and will do anything to protect their family. Health Issues Cairns are prone to several health issues, including cataracts, hip dysplasia, and allergies. They can also develop skin conditions due to their shaggy coat. Regular grooming and veterinary check-ups are essential for keeping your Cairn healthy.
West Highland White Terrier: The "Westie"
The West Highland White Terrier, or "Westie" for short, is a small Scottish dog breed that is known for its spunky personality and white coat. These dogs were originally bred for hunting rodents, but they make great family pets due to their friendly nature.
Breed Overview: - HEIGHT:Ā 10 to 11 inches - WEIGHT:Ā 13 to 20 pounds - PHYSICAL CHARACTERISTICS:Ā Small in stature; white fur; medium-length double coat Appearance and Characteristics Westies are small dogs that typically weigh between 15 and 20 pounds. They have a white, double coat that is thick and wiry. Their ears are pointed and stand erect, and their tails are short and carried straight up. Personality Traits Westies are friendly, outgoing dogs that love to play and cuddle. They are intelligent and have a strong desire to please their owners, which makes them easy to train. Westies are also known for their loyalty and will protect their family if they feel threatened. Health Issues Westies are prone to several health issues, including skin allergies, hip dysplasia, and a condition called globoid cell leukodystrophy. Regular veterinary check-ups and a healthy diet are essential for keeping your Westie healthy.

The history of the #puli leads back as far as 5500 years ago, today #Hungary is the official country of origin. Don't let the hair fool ya, with a sharp eyesight, sensitive hearing, and a suspicious nature towards strangers, the Puli is serious about his responsibility as a watchdog and is more than willing to back up its bark with a bite. . Fun fact: During WWII Pulis left behind were shot by the Germans and Russians seeking to silence the barking Puli. On a positive note, around the mid 1800's the breed was one of the most expensive dogs to acquire as the price of a GOOD Puli puppy was about equal to the earnings of a shepherd for a full year. . It's not a #scottie nor a #cairn but both breeds played an important role in the development of the #westhighlandwhiteterrier Originating from #scotland the breed is highly energetic and usually possessive of its owners, toys and food. Along with it being independent and stubborn, these traits completes it to be a competent watchdog. . Fun fact: The #westies "white coats" was a desirable quality in their later history as it easily distinguished them from their game in hunts. This is important to note as in their early history, white puppies were culled as they were deemed "weak" compared to the darker sandy colored or brindle dogs. . The #softcoatedwheatenterrier was bred in #ireland for over two hundred years as an all purpose dog (herding, vermin and watchdog) Although a terrier at heart, the Wheaten is not as scrappy as other terriers. Highly intelligent yet head strong, energetic with a high prey drive finishes this dog as a more than capable watchdog. . Fun fact: Known as enthusiastic greeter's one will often find a Wheaten's jumping up to lick your face, within the breed this is commonly referred to as the "Wheaten Greeten" The breed was commonly referred to as the "poor man's wolfhound" as in the extra large #irishwolfhound this is because only the gentry (the class below nobility) were allowed to own large dogs, so terriers like the Wheaten were left for the lower class to use. .
